After flying high against Triangle Math & Science on Tuesday, NCSSM: Durham came back down to earth. The Unicorns came up short against the East Wake Academy Eagles on Wednesday, falling 3-0. The Unicorns were not able to repeat the success they had when they faced the Eagles earlier this season, when they won 3-0.

While NCSSM: Durham ultimately came up short, they really made East Wake Academy work, particularly in the first set.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 26-24, 25-23, 25-21.

Mariam Hassanen paced NCSSM: Durham's offense, picking up five kills. Hassanen got some help from Chloe Harnphanich and her nine assists. Hassanen was also solid from the service line: she led the team with three aces.

East Wake Academy found their leader in sophomore Avery Schmidt, who had 32 assists and 20 digs. Schmidt has been hot, having posted 16 or more assists the last seven times she's played. Another player making a difference was Emerson Morris, who had ten kills, six digs, four blocks, and three aces.

NCSSM: Durham's loss dropped their record down to 12-9. As for East Wake Academy, they are on a roll lately: they've won six of their last seven contests. That's provided a nice bump to their 12-7 record this season.
